我一直想知道是否可以使用mysqli_query()创建一个新的数据库,即使我已经连接到我的数据库了?
$create_new_db = mysqli_query($user_conn, "CREATE DATABASE sample_db");
if($create_new_db) {
echo 'new database has been created';
} else {
echo 'Error while creating new database.';
}
我的变量$ user_conn有一个名为db_maindb的数据库连接。当我连接到db_maindb数据库时,仍然可以创建一个新数据库吗?
答案 0 :(得分:3)
就像你在代码中一样......
假设您可以连接到现有数据库,并且您的已连接用户已获得create database的授权,您可以
act()